Abstract

Automotive information services utilizing vehicle data are rapidlyexpanding. However, there is currently no data centric softwarearchitecture that takes into account the scale and complexity of datainvolving numerous sensors. To address this issue, the authors havedeveloped an in-vehicle data-stream management system for automotiveembedded systems (eDSMS) as data centric software architecture.Providing the data stream functionalities to drivers and passengers arehighly beneficial. This paper describes a vehicle embedded data streamprocessing platform for Android devices. The platform enables flexiblequery processing with a dataflow query language and extensible operatorfunctions in the query language on the platform. The platform employsarchitecture independent of data stream schema in in-vehicle eDSMS tofacilitate smoother Android application program development. This paperpresents specifications and design of the query language and APIs of theplatform, evaluate it, and discuss the results.
